/* default element override */
#Body {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	background: url(img/bg.jpg) transparent repeat scroll center center;
}
table, td {
	text-align: left;
	vertical-align: top;
}
a, a:link, avisited{
font-family: Verdana, Arial, Helvetica, sans-serif;	
}

a:hover {
	cursor: pointer;
}
img, a img, a {
	border: 0;
	padding: 0;
	margin: 0;
}
table, td {
	border-collapse: collapse;
	padding: 0;
	margin: 0;
	border: 0;
}
.clearing {
	clear: both;
}
/*default module titles */
.Head {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11pt;
	font-weight: bold;
}
.SubHead {
}
.SubSubHead {
}
/* default for container content */
.Normal {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 8pt;
}
/* custom styles */
/*links module only- custom code*/
.linkbackground {
}
.searchbar {
	float: right;
}
.searchbar, .searchbar a, .searchbar a:link, .searchbar a:visited {
	font-size: 9pt;
	font-weight: bold;
	text-decoration: none;
	color: black;
}

.dnn2links, .dnn2links a {
	/* to match menu */
font-family: Verdana, Arial, Helvetica, sans-serif;
}
.dnn2links {
	padding-right: 20px;
}
.premiumlogin, .premiumlogin a, .premiumlogin a:link, .premiumlogin a:visited {
	background: url(img/bg.jpg) transparent repeat scroll center center;
	color: #545454;
	font-size: 8pt;
}
.premiumlogin a:hover {
	color: #111;
}
/* 
================================
Skin styles for DotNetNuke
================================
*/
.fixedwidth {
	width: 960px;
}
.bsfooter {
	width: 960px;
}
.pagemaster {
	background: url(img/bg.jpg) transparent repeat scroll center center;
	width: 100%;
}
.skinmaster {
	width: 960px;
	background: #fff;
	margin: 0 auto;
}
.innercontentframe {
	width: 765px;
}
/* static menu */
div.menu-topborder {
	height: 13px;
}
td.menu1 {
	text-align: center;
	background: url(img/banner.jpg) transparent no-repeat scroll center bottom;
	height: 26px;
}
div.menu1 {
	padding-top: 2px;
	padding-bottom: 2px;
}
.menu1 a, .menu1 a:link, .menu1 a:visited, .menu1 a:hover {
	color: #000;
	text-decoration: none;
	font-weight: bold;
	font-size: 10pt;
}
.menu1 a:hover {
	color: #fff;
}
.menu1 span {
}
.navbar {
	background: #000033;
/* height: 26px; */	width: 100%;
}
.sidemenu {
	width: 195px;
	background: #000;
}
.controlpanel {
	width: 100%;
	background-color: #dddddd;
}
.topbanner {
	width: 960px;
	height: 199px;
	background: url(img/banner.jpg) transparent no-repeat scroll top center;
}
/*global panes */
.toppane, .leftpane, .contentpane, .rightpane, .bottompane {
	background-color: transparent;
	padding-left: 6px;
	padding-right: 4px;
	padding-top: 6px;
}
.toppane {
	width: 100%;
}
.leftpane {
	width: 70%;
}
.contentpane {
	width: 100%;
}
.rightpane {
	width: 30%;
}
.bottompane {
	width: 100%;
}
.floatright {
	float: right;
}
.floatleft {
	float: left;
}

